John Gibson, Ducks net win against Stars

Ducks, Stars

John Gibson made 26 saves to pick up the win in his 500th NHL game as the host Anaheim Ducks edged the Dallas Stars 2-1 on Tuesday night.

It was the 202nd career victory for Gibson, who became the 11th active goaltender and 85th in NHL history to hit the 500-game mark.

Trevor Zegras and Cutter Gauthier scored for Anaheim, which won for the fifth time in six games. It was the Ducks’ first victory scoring two goals or less since a season-opening 2-0 shutout of San Jose on Oct. 12, making Anaheim just 2-24-4 for the season in that department.

Colin Blackwell scored and Jake Oettinger made 26 saves for Dallas, which had a five-game winning streak snapped. It marked the first loss of Oettinger’s career in nine starts against the Ducks.

Anaheim took a 1-0 lead at the 17:47 mark of the first period when Gauthier picked up a loose puck in the slot and then whipped a wrist shot into the upper right corner of the net.

Dallas tied it 1-1 early in the third period. Sam Steel hit Blackwell, who roofed a wrist shot, cutting down the slot with a backhand pass from the left circle.

The Ducks regained the lead just 2:38 later when Zegras, alone in front of the net, redirected Alex Killorn’s no-look pass from the left circle over Oettinger’s right shoulder for the game-winner.

Oettinger was pulled for an extra attacker with 2:08 remaining. After Frank Vatrano missed a shot at the empty net, Gibson made a glove save on a point-blank wrist shot by Wyatt Johnston from the bottom edge of the left circle.

Then Gibson sealed the win with another save — on Jason Robertson’s wrist shot from the right edge of the crease with 19 seconds left.
